Job description:
We are seeking a compassionate and dedicated Adoption Social Worker to join our team. In this role, you will play a vital part in the adoption process, working closely with pregnant individuals and families to learn about the process of adoption and placement.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in social work and experience in child welfare, particularly in adoption and working with individuals with diverse socio-economic needs.
Duties:
- Provide guidance and support to families throughout the adoption process, addressing any concerns or questions they may have.
- Assist biological families/parents in connecting with social support programs including Medicaid, health services, SNAP and other programs
- Explore open adoption with families
- Collaborate with child protective services and other agencies to ensure the best interests of the child are prioritized.
- Coordinate with hospital staff for care and discharge
- Provide reunification services for adoptees
- Provide individual therapy to adoptive parents, adoptees and birth parents
- Maintain accurate records and documentation related to each case, adhering to confidentiality standards.
- Participate in training and professional development opportunities to stay current on best practices in social work and adoption.
Requirements:
- Master’s degree in social work or related field.
- Experience working with children and families, particularly in child welfare or childcare settings.
- Knowledge of adoption processes and regulations.
- Familiarity with child protective services and resources available for individuals with developmental disabilities.
- Strong interpersonal skills with the ability to effectively communicate with diverse populations.
- Ability to handle sensitive situations with empathy and professionalism.
